About Tianmeng Liu

Tianmeng Liu is a scholar working on Ecological Modeling, Plant Science and Automotive Engineering, having authored 17 papers that have together received 656 indexed citations. Recurring topics across this work include Advancements in Battery Materials (6 papers), Advanced Battery Materials and Technologies (5 papers) and Plant Molecular Biology Research (4 papers). The work is most often cited by research in Automotive Engineering (119 citations), Ecological Modeling (36 citations) and Electrical and Electronic Engineering (270 citations). Tianmeng Liu has collaborated with scholars based in China, Australia and United States. Frequent co-authors include Guanglei Cui, Zhonghua Zhang, Jianming Wang, Xiaokang Hu, Jianmeng Feng, Huanrui Zhang, Guicun Li, Jingchao Chai, Pengxian Han and Xiaoqi Han. Their work appears in journals such as Proceedings of the National Academy of Sciences, The Science of The Total Environment and PLANT PHYSIOLOGY.
